Skip to content

Instantly share code, notes, and snippets.

@cmllr
Created January 31, 2016 17:03
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save cmllr/94873df4dc4a4c614b3c to your computer and use it in GitHub Desktop.
Save cmllr/94873df4dc4a4c614b3c to your computer and use it in GitHub Desktop.
vserver-fragen
[{
"Text": "Wie erstelle ich einen Ordner?",
"Answers": [{
"Text": "cd",
"IsTrue": false
}, {
"Text": "mkdir",
"IsTrue": true
}, {
"Text": "chmod",
"IsTrue": false
}, {
"Text": "Ich kenne keine Terminalbefehle",
"IsTrue": false
}],
"Image": null,
"Identifier": 0,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 5
}, {
"Text": "Ich will folgendes in meinem vServer einsetzen",
"Answers": [{
"Text": "Ich nutze ein als Server angepasstes System",
"IsTrue": true
}, {
"Text": "Ich installiere eine Oberfl\u00e4che und arbeite mit dieser",
"IsTrue": false
}],
"Image": null,
"Identifier": 1,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 2
}, {
"Text": "Ein Hacker hat dich gehackt. Was tust du?",
"Answers": [{
"Text": "Nichts. Bekommt ja keiner mit.",
"IsTrue": false
}, {
"Text": "Mein Passwort \u00e4ndern.",
"IsTrue": true
}, {
"Text": "sudo dd if=\/dev\/zero of=\/dev\/sda",
"IsTrue": false
}, {
"Text": "meine Nutzer warnen und das System neu (und u.a. mit besseren Passw\u00f6rtern) aufsetzen",
"IsTrue": true
}],
"Image": "https://snap-photos.s3.amazonaws.com/img-thumbs/960w/SEVPWIOFCM.jpg",
"Identifier": 2,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Was solltest du in \/etc\/ssh\/sshd_config \u00e4ndern?",
"Answers": [{
"Text": "Banner \/etc\/issue.net",
"IsTrue": false
}, {
"Text": "\"PermitRootLogin\" auf \"without-password\" oder \"no\" setzen",
"IsTrue": true
}, {
"Text": "Port auf etwas \u00fcber 5000 \u00e4ndern",
"IsTrue": true
}],
"Image": null,
"Identifier": 3,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 2
}, {
"Text": "Wie mache ich ein Backup?",
"Answers": [{
"Text": "dd if=\/dev\/null of=\/dev\/sda",
"IsTrue": false
}, {
"Text": "[Auf einem anderen server] rsync -Pzchvr --stats root@{DOMAIN}:\/verzeichnis \/backup",
"IsTrue": true
}, {
"Text": "rm -r --no-preserve-root \/",
"IsTrue": false
}],
"Image": null,
"Identifier": 4,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 5
}, {
"Text": "Mit welchem Benutzer f\u00fchre ich Cronjobs aus?",
"Answers": [{
"Text": "Was ist ein Cronjob?",
"IsTrue": false
}, {
"Text": "Mit meinem Benutzer",
"IsTrue": true
}, {
"Text": "Alles mit dem Root-Benutzer",
"IsTrue": false
}],
"Image": null,
"Identifier": 5,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 4
}, {
"Text": "Mit Welchem Benutzer arbeite ich haupts\u00e4chlich?",
"Answers": [{
"Text": "Mit meinem Benutzer",
"IsTrue": true
}, {
"Text": "Alles mit dem Root-Benutzer",
"IsTrue": false
}],
"Image": null,
"Identifier": 6,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 8
}, {
"Text": "Wie oft aktualisiere ich die Software auf meinem Server?",
"Answers": [{
"Text": "Regelm\u00e4\u00dfig (w\u00f6chentlich, monatlich)",
"IsTrue": true
}, {
"Text": "Ich installiere Updates automatisch",
"IsTrue": false
}],
"Image": null,
"Identifier": 7,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Passw\u00f6rter",
"Answers": [{
"Text": "F\u00fcr jeden Benutzer\/ Dienst eigene Passw\u00f6rter. Ich benutze generierte Passw\u00f6rter.",
"IsTrue": true
}, {
"Text": "Ich benutze \u00fcberall das gleiche Passwort, weil es einfacher ist",
"IsTrue": false
}, {
"Text": "Mein Passwort klebt unter meiner Tastatur",
"IsTrue": false
}],
"Image": null,
"Identifier": 8,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Was ist chown?",
"Answers": [{
"Text": "Ein Programm, um den Besitzer einer Dateisystemeintrags zu \u00e4ndern",
"IsTrue": true
}, {
"Text": "Ein Tool um torrents auf meinem Server runterzuladen",
"IsTrue": false
}],
"Image": null,
"Identifier": 9,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Was setze ich als Dateisystem ein?",
"Answers": [{
"Text": "Bei Linux ext, ZFS oder XFS",
"IsTrue": true
}, {
"Text": "Ich benutze \u00fcberall NTFS",
"IsTrue": false
}],
"Image": null,
"Identifier": 10,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 7
}, {
"Text": "Solltest du \"chmod 777 -R \/\" ausf\u00fchren?",
"Answers": [{
"Text": "Ja, ist doch nichts dabei!",
"IsTrue": false
}, {
"Text": "Auf gar keinen Fall",
"IsTrue": true
}, {
"Text": "- Nein, aber im verzeichnis \"\/var\/www\/\" sollte ich das wenn Fehler mit Berechtigungen auftreten!",
"IsTrue": false
}],
"Image": null,
"Identifier": 11,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 7
}, {
"Text": "Ist \"curl http:\/\/github\/XXXXXXX | sudo bash\" eine gute Idee?",
"Answers": [{
"Text": "Ja, ist doch nichts dabei!",
"IsTrue": false
}, {
"Text": "Auf gar keinen Fall",
"IsTrue": true
}],
"Image": null,
"Identifier": 12,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Ist dir Hardening ein Begriff?",
"Answers": [{
"Text": "Nat\u00fcrlich.",
"IsTrue": true
}, {
"Text": "Nein",
"IsTrue": false
}],
"Image": null,
"Identifier": 13,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Solltest du anderen Zugriff per telnet\/ SSH auf deinen Server geben?",
"Answers": [{
"Text": "Nat\u00fcrlich.",
"IsTrue": false
}, {
"Text": "Nein",
"IsTrue": true
}, {
"Text": "Wenn ich sie l\u00e4nger als 5 Minuten kennen und sie mir helfen wollen einen Minecraft server zu installieren, Ja!",
"IsTrue": false
}],
"Image": null,
"Identifier": 14,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Wie konfiguriere ich meinen Webserver?",
"Answers": [{
"Text": "Ich mache mich \u00fcber die Bedeutungen der Konfiguration schlau und stelle den Webserver entsprechend ein.",
"IsTrue": true
}, {
"Text": "Ich \u00e4ndere nur die Werte, die mir das Tutorial vorgibt.",
"IsTrue": false
}],
"Image": null,
"Identifier": 15,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Wie konfiguirere ich meinen Webserver?",
"Answers": [{
"Text": "Ich mache mich \u00fcber die Bedeutungen der Konfiguration schlau und stelle den Webserver entsprechend ein.",
"IsTrue": true
}, {
"Text": "Ich \u00e4ndere nur die Werte, die mir das Tutorial vorgibt.",
"IsTrue": false
}],
"Image": null,
"Identifier": 16,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}, {
"Text": "Welche WordPress version solltest du benutzen?",
"Answers": [{
"Text": "Die aus dem 2 jahre altem Tutorial das ich mir grade auf Youtube angeschaut hab! Er hat sogar ein skript geschrieben das ich nur noch runterladen und starten muss und das alles f\u00fcr mich macht!",
"IsTrue": false
}, {
"Text": "Die die ich noch so auf meinem Desktop rumliegen hab",
"IsTrue": false
}, {
"Text": "Das aktuellste! Das ist am sichersten.",
"IsTrue": true
}],
"Image": null,
"Identifier": 17,
"ChoosedAnswers": null,
"IsMarked": null,
"ErrorPoints": 10
}]
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ment